John Deere 6120M AutoPowr

The John Deere 6120M AutoPowr recently won the Best Utility category in the TOTY competition. It went up against some of the best in the business yet the jury found this tractor to be the best in its class. Here are four reasons why the John Deere 6120m AutoPowr won Best Utility Tractor for 2022.

What is a utility tractor?

The John Deere 6120M is a multipurpose tractor with a powerful four-cylinder engine; a maximum operating weight of 10,500kg and a maximum wheelbase of 2,550mm. It is relatively compact yet able to handle any situation.

1. Winning formula

As mentioned, the John Deere 6120M AutoPowr makes use of a powerful four cylinder motor in the form of the PowrTech EWS engine. It is a 4.5-litre power unit producing 90kW but is able to boost up to 108kW when needed. It also benefits from 562Nm of torque at 1 600rpm.

Adding to the impressive engine is the inclusion of the brand's improved stepless transmission which now features a minimum speed of 50m per hour. The transmission allows for a speed range of up to 40kph which can be reached at as little as 1 470rpm.

2. Lifting capabilities

The John Deere 6120M is fitted with a unique pressure and flow compensated hydraulic system with loading sensing capabilities. It is able to offer around  114l/per minute, with an independent hydrostatic steering pump which uses flow metering technology. The rear linkage can lift up to 5 700kg, while the optional front linkage can carry up to 4 400kg.

 

3. Ease of use

Ground clearance offered by the John Deere 6120M ranges from 364mm to 559mm depending on tyre size. The steering angle is rated at 52 degrees which enables a possible turning circle of 4.35m. The unladen weight is 6 000kg with a maximum operating weight of 10 450kg.

4. Interior comfort

In order to improve cabin comfort, the 6120M features mechanical cab suspension as standard fitment. This is further complemented by the in-house Triple Link Suspension hydro-pneumatic system on the front axle.

The cabin also comes with air conditioning and offers a noise level of just 70dB. Technological assistance is offered by the full John Deere precision farming technology suite which includes ISOBUS functionality, variable rate and section control, guidance systems and the JDLink fleet management.
